Day In The Life: As an Back-End Pharmacy Technician, you will work to ensure all medication needs and regulatory standards are met for our patients. You will work in various workstations allowing you to grow your skillsets further. Our back-end team focuses on order fulfillment in our closed-door pharmacy setting, including packaging and dispensing of medication, reviewing delivery orders and bins for accuracy, and coordinating stock rotations. Additional tasks and responsibilities include:

  • Rotating and working in various assigned pharmacy workstations including: Packaging, Staging, Returns, Receiving, Narcotics, IV, Ekit, Compounding, Omnicell Cycle Fill, Machine Packaging
  • Receiving product deliveries, pull and stage product for distribution, rotate stock, and coordinate activities with drivers to ensure shipments are accurate and deliveries are timely
  • Performing physical inventories of medication
